BAD MOTOR ACCIDENT

THREE PERSONS INJURED. At about 11 o'clock Dust night a Serious motor accidentl occurred, a oar driven by Mr W. Hunwick, of Waipuku, colliding with a ' telegraph post on Ch.eal Road. • As a result three persons were admitted to the Hospital. Mr. Hunwick received severe lacerations on the face and right hand, and a bone in the right hand is broken. ;

Miss Mavis Ashton had her right thigh broken and suffered a compound fracture of the skull, with severe cerebral laceration. On ladmission to the hospital her condition was! very critical.

Miss Cora Smith is suffering from cuts and shock.
